SFYF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2022 in Review
8 of the 5,806 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in SoFi Social 50 ETF (SFYF) for Q3 2022, worth a combined $1.57M — up 4.4% from $1.5M a quarter earlier.
Fund positioning in SFYF was balanced in Q3 2022: 0 funds opened new positions, 0 closed out, 3 added to existing stakes and 2 trimmed.
The largest buyer was UBS Group, adding an estimated $115K. The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, cutting an estimated $69.4K.
